I finally got my truck back together and drivable and decided it was time to start over on my other truck. Luckily they are the same year model. The green truck is a 95 GMC Sierra and the tan truck is a 95 Chevy Silverado. I will be posting pics here as I rebuild. The green truck just has too many problems that need to be fixed. It needs a roof skin and motor rebuild among other things. So I just opted to rebuild the motor and rebuild on my other stock truck.
The plans for the new truck is to keep the denali clip and stepside bed and 22's. Rebuild the motor with vortec heads, cam, and possibly a bigger TBI. The rendering in my sig is what the final outcome will be.
